Site Manager (National)

Site Manager (National)

London Full-Time 48000 - 72000 £ / year (est.) No home office possible
B

At a Glance

  • Tasks: Lead exciting projects in automation technology and manage installation works nationwide.
  • Company: BEUMER Group is a global leader in high-tech intralogistics systems, known for innovation and teamwork.
  • Benefits: Enjoy health support, shopping discounts, and increased holiday entitlement with service.
  • Why this job: Shape the future of logistics while travelling and working on cutting-edge projects.
  • Qualifications: HNC/HND or equivalent, with preferred certifications like SSSTS, SMSTS, and First Aid.
  • Other info: Opportunities for international travel and a dynamic work environment.

The predicted salary is between 48000 - 72000 £ per year.

London Borough of Hillingdon, United Kingdom. BEUMER Group is a leader within the development and manufacture of high-technological intralogistics systems for global markets. Our employees stand out from others thanks to their ability to supply innovative solutions to our customers. They can do this because they know the industry and are passionate about continuously developing and expanding their knowledge. We support these high standards through teamwork, mutual respect and a working culture based on trust that fosters stability and security for all of our employees. Our common goal is to implement outstanding and innovative projects worldwide.

Join BEUMER Group as a Site Manager based at our Heathrow site, working nationally at other sites and locations, where you'll lead dynamic projects at the forefront of automation technology, with opportunities to travel nationwide and shape the future of logistics infrastructure.

Key Role:

As Site Manager you will be responsible for all aspects of the installation works of sortation/material handling systems and airport baggage systems, including Health & Safety, Quality and Progress. Planning and co-ordination of equipment delivery, in line with project schedule, ensuring installation is on schedule and that quality standards are met. You will be responsible for the management of BEUMER Supervisors and our approved sub-contractors ensuring effective communication on site, deliveries etc., are requested in a timely manner, site cleanliness is adhered to, and installation is on target. You will be responsible for reviewing installation progress reports from sub-contractors and reporting progress to the Project / Construction Manager. Update and track all site related issues / open points, ensure Level 6 checklists are complete and facilitate a structured handover to Commissioning. This role will involve travelling nationwide (including Ireland) as well as some international travel. Prepare an initial Installation plan, installation strategy, warehouse planning, plant and equipment for site activities. Provide preliminary input to the project time schedule and contribute continuously with input from relevant stakeholders such as Installation Supervisors, sub-suppliers, etc. Contribute to risk register, resource plan and budget update regarding installation. Facilitate site meetings and produce relevant documentation to align with the Principal Contractor / Client / local suppliers. Attend BEUMER 'GATE' meetings including 'Ready for Installation' and 'Installation Complete'. Plan and coordinate all site activities, including third party trades and other contractors working in the area.

Qualifications:

HNC/HND or Equivalent SSSTS or SMSTS (preferred), First Aid at Work, IPAF, IOSH or NEBOSH (preferred). Ideally should have an Airside security pass.

Additional Information:

Health and wellbeing support, including shopping discounts. Recommend a friend initiative. Increase in holiday entitlement with service.

Site Manager (National) employer: BEUMER Group GmbH & Co. KG

BEUMER Group is an exceptional employer, offering a dynamic work environment at our Heathrow site where innovation and teamwork thrive. With a strong focus on employee development, we provide opportunities for growth through hands-on experience in cutting-edge automation technology and a culture built on trust and mutual respect. Our commitment to health and wellbeing, alongside competitive benefits such as increased holiday entitlement with service and shopping discounts, makes BEUMER Group a rewarding place to advance your career in logistics infrastructure.
B

Contact Detail:

BEUMER Group GmbH & Co. KG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Site Manager (National)

✨Tip Number 1

Familiarise yourself with the latest trends in automation technology and intralogistics systems. This knowledge will not only help you during interviews but also demonstrate your passion for the industry, which is something we value highly at StudySmarter.

✨Tip Number 2

Network with professionals in the logistics and construction sectors. Attend industry events or join relevant online forums to connect with others who may have insights into the role of a Site Manager. This can lead to valuable referrals or recommendations.

✨Tip Number 3

Prepare to discuss your experience with project management and team leadership. Be ready to share specific examples of how you've successfully managed installations or coordinated teams in previous roles, as this will be crucial for the Site Manager position.

✨Tip Number 4

Research BEUMER Group's recent projects and achievements. Understanding our company’s values and recent developments will allow you to tailor your discussions and show that you're genuinely interested in contributing to our innovative projects.

We think you need these skills to ace Site Manager (National)

Project Management
Health and Safety Compliance
Installation Planning
Team Leadership
Effective Communication
Quality Assurance
Risk Management
Resource Planning
Budget Management
Problem-Solving Skills
Time Management
Knowledge of Intralogistics Systems
Site Coordination
Stakeholder Engagement
Technical Aptitude

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ant experience in site management, particularly in installation works and project coordination. Emphasise any previous roles that involved health and safety compliance, as well as your ability to manage teams effectively.

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for logistics and automation technology. Mention specific projects you've led or contributed to, and how your skills align with the responsibilities outlined in the job description.

Highlight Relevant Qualifications: Clearly list your qualifications such as HNC/HND, SSSTS or SMSTS, and any other certifications like First Aid at Work or IOSH. If you have an Airside security pass, make sure to mention it as it is preferred for this role.

Showcase Your Leadership Skills: In your application, provide examples of how you've successfully managed teams and communicated effectively on-site. Highlight your experience in coordinating with subcontractors and ensuring project timelines are met.

How to prepare for a job interview at BEUMER Group GmbH & Co. KG

✨Know Your Technical Stuff

As a Site Manager, you'll be dealing with complex systems. Brush up on your knowledge of sortation and material handling systems, as well as any relevant health and safety regulations. Be prepared to discuss how your technical expertise can contribute to the projects at BEUMER Group.

✨Showcase Your Leadership Skills

You'll be managing teams and subcontractors, so it's crucial to demonstrate your leadership abilities. Share examples from your past experiences where you successfully led a team or managed a project, highlighting your communication and coordination skills.

✨Prepare for Scenario Questions

Expect questions that assess your problem-solving skills and ability to handle unexpected challenges on site. Think of scenarios where you had to adapt your plans or resolve conflicts, and be ready to explain your thought process and outcomes.

✨Emphasise Your Commitment to Safety

Health and safety are paramount in this role. Be prepared to discuss your qualifications like SSSTS or SMSTS, and share your approach to maintaining a safe working environment. Highlight any initiatives you've implemented in the past to improve safety standards.

B
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>